How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Scottsville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Scottsville Studio Apartments | $1,186 | $1,025 | $1,365 |
Scottsville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,572 | $1,145 | $2,155 |
Scottsville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,829 | $999 | $2,695 |
Scottsville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,360 | $1,645 | $2,995 |
Scottsville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$829 | $749 | $900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Scottsville
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Scottsville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Scottsville ranges from $1,145 to $2,155 with an average monthly rent of $1,572.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Scottsville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Scottsville range from $999 to $2,695.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,829.
How expensive are Scottsville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 20 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Scottsville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,645 to $2,995 - averaging $2,360 for the location.
